Casino bonuses for a new account
A new player at Ginga effectively has three doors. The welcome match is the big one: a percentage added to the first deposit, credited within seconds of the payment clearing and locked behind a wagering requirement in the 30-35× range. Free spins frequently ride along with it, usually on a named Gamzix or Kalamba slot such as Coin Win Hold The Spin or Temple Of Thunder 3, and their winnings arrive as bonus balance rather than cash. The third door — a no deposit bonus — is a campaign rather than a fixture; when it appears at all it comes with a heavier multiple and a firm ceiling on what can be withdrawn.
The practical order is simple. Open the account and finish verification first, because Ginga asks for a citizen card or passport, a utility bill under three months old and proof of the payment method before any payout, and doing that upfront saves days later. Then read the offer, then deposit. The full sequence is on the registration guide.
Current offers for an account that is already open
Once the welcome tier is spent, the calendar keeps turning. Reload offers add a percentage to a repeat deposit, generally at a lower rate than the welcome match but claimable week after week. Cashback pays back a slice of net losses — the friendliest promotion on the site, since it costs nothing to trigger and its wagering is nominal. The VIP ladder accrues in the background from real-money turnover and pays out as higher rebate percentages, priority payout handling and, at the top, a named contact. Refer a friend sits slightly apart: it rewards you for bringing in a player who was going to join anyway.
For a player who deposits €20 or €30 at a time, the combination of cashback plus a single weekly reload is almost always worth more over a month than one large welcome credit that has to be cleared in a hurry.

The three numbers that decide the best casino bonus
Ignore the percentage on the banner for a moment and look at three figures instead. First, the wagering multiple: a €50 bonus at 35× means €1,750 must be staked before anything converts. Second, the max bet while bonus funds are active — €5 per spin at Ginga — because a single larger stake can void the whole balance. Third, the expiry: 30 days on the welcome offer, often only 7 on a reload. An offer you can finish comfortably beats a bigger one you cannot, every time.
Game weighting is the hidden fourth number. Slots count in full, roulette contributes 10-20% and blackjack or baccarat only 5-10%, so clearing a bonus at an Evolution table takes many times longer than on a Nolimit City slot. The wagering page carries the full contribution table.
Minimum deposit and which payment rails qualify
Bonus eligibility is tied to the deposit, so the rail you choose matters. MB WAY, Multibanco, Trustly, Skrill and Paysafecard all start at €20 and clear instantly, which makes them the standard route into any promotion. A SEPA bank transfer needs €25 and lands the following working day, so a same-day offer can expire before the money arrives. USDT and Litecoin start at around €50 — fine for a large welcome claim, oversized for a €20 reload.
One quirk is worth planning around: Paysafecard is deposit-only. You can trigger a bonus with it, but the resulting withdrawal has to leave by bank transfer or Skrill instead, which means submitting a second method to verification. Method by method, the numbers are on the payments overview.
What the SRIJ context means for a bonus dispute
In Portugal, legal online gambling is licensed by the SRIJ, the Serviço de Regulação e Inspeção de Jogos of Turismo de Portugal, and licensed operators are listed in the SRIJ public register. Ginga operates under an international licence, not an SRIJ one. That matters here specifically because bonus disputes are the most common kind of complaint a player files: on an SRIJ-licensed site the promotional rules fall under Portuguese player-protection law, and on an international site they do not. Check the licence number in the operator's footer, match it against the regulator's public register, and understand that a bonus argument will be settled by the operator's own terms and its licensing body rather than by a Portuguese authority.
